Q: Is 607,473 a Prime Number?
A: No, 607,473 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 607473 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 27 149 151 447 453 1,341 1,359 4,023 4,077 22,499 67,497 202,491 and 607,473, with no remainder.
Since 607,473 cannot be divided by just 1 and 607,473, it is not a prime number.
